How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- holding that \located\ in predecessor of 28 U.S.C. sec. 1348 referred only to a national bank’s principal place of business
- concluding that Congress would have plainly stated any intent to effect noteworthy departure from the general rule
- holding that a national bank is \located\ only at its principal place of business under the 1887 Act, on analogy to the par- allel rule for corporations
- holding national bank with branch in Oregon was not citizen thereof for diversity purposes under predecessor of section 1348
- coming to the same result but on the theory payment by the surety company destroyed the claim by the principal against the bank so nothing remained to be assigned. A questionable theory to say the least
